Software Engineer Datakitchen
Role details
Job location
Tech stack
Job description
- Build DataKitchen v2 to give customers flexibility in how they design, operate, and scale their DataKitchen workflows.
- Create a paved road for publishing DataKitchen-built data models into Power BI.
- Ensure long-term product quality and customer success through strong onboarding of customers, proactive refactoring, and continuous improvements., * Enhance the core engine with smart data processing techniques, comprehensive validation, and performance optimization. Requires solid OOP Python skills, clean and maintainable code, and a passion for testing and optimization challenges.
- Extend our CI/CD pipelines - built with GitHub Actions - to support customer workflows and improve user experience.
- Develop and improve Terraform IaC modules to deploy user models and supporting assets on Databricks.
- Stay current with Databricks platform developments and the broader data landscape to ensure we are able to provide users with cutting-edge techniques and tools.
- Maintain fresh and accurate documentation that users can trust and rely on.
Your new team and office.
Together with your team of (Product Owners/Backend Developers/Mobile Developers) you will work on inspiring projects to accelerate our transition into a hybrid Food & Tech company. We want to leverage data and technology to future-proof food shopping and give our customers accessibility to healthy food more easily available for everyone. At Albert Heijn, you team up with inspiring peers in the data, digital and tech domains. A community of diverse individuals who share a common goal; to create digital solutions that make (online) shopping simpler and more inspiring. Are you ready to reinvent the way millions of people buy and enjoy their food? We invest heavily in data, digital and tech. And that includes investing in your career! Our teams work in a hybrid way: both from home as well as in the office. We are located right next to the train station Zaandam.
Requirements
- 4+ years of experience as a Software Engineer
- Strong proficiency in Python and SQL
- Experience with GitHub Actions
- Experience with Cloud platforms, preferably Microsoft Azure
- Experience with Spark and/or Databricks
- Experience with Terraform is a plus
- Solid understanding of data modelling concepts
- Strong communication and collaboration skills, able to work effectively with both technical and non-technical stakeholders
- You're tech savvy, pro-active and have a big passion for tech
Benefits & conditions
We think it's important to be part of an high-belonging team; a team where you can be yourself and feel safe, accepted and appreciated. For this job we are preferably looking for someone who brings diversity in our team, in the widest possible sense. Someone who is a great addition to our team by bringing other ideas to the table. So don't check all the boxes? Don't worry, we probably don't either . Don't hesitate to apply if you think you are up for the challenge, we're happy to have a look at your resume!
What we offer.
At Albert Heijn we aim to grow, and this is only possible if you grow along with us. As we work together to build our brand and your career, you can count on (based on 40 hours per week):
- An annual salary up to 80K including holiday allowance and a flexible bonus. Depending on your experience;
- 45 days of paid leave to enjoy your well-deserved holidays: 25,5 regular vacation days and 19,5 ADV days. Enjoy!
- Flexible working hours;
- Access to a challenging training curriculum - AH Tech Academy;
- An excellent pension plan where we as an employer contribute 4,5 more than you as an employee;
- A travel allowance or a NS-business card for traveling to and from Zaandam by train;
- Attractive discounts on various insurance policies;
- 10% staff discount on groceries in all Albert Heijn stores, to a maximum of €300 per year;
- A free Mijn Albert Heijn Premium membership with many benefits;
- A company laptop and telephone.